Output 3b1596813c15bf0dc9651152e180cadab715abe7d15f18475766894e29faab0b:5

value
40159714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d6b3e680d5e3f4c8b487b1b66d39b4046903f95 OP_EQUAL
address
MDVuvZS213femwfAH7kt1LK4jLcAcVxc8W
transaction
3b1596813c15bf0dc9651152e180cadab715abe7d15f18475766894e29faab0b
spent
true